Do I need to stop my PPI before I get another breath test ?

Re: Normal stool

Posted: Sat Apr 28, 2018 11:24 pm
by Helico_expert
Yes, you will have to stop PPI for at least 2 weeks (better result after a month) before breath test.

However, you can switch to ranitidine and continue until the night before breath test.
